SummaryThe purpose of the position is to build the capacity of school staff to implement a variety of positive behavior intervention strategies to support the emotional, social, and behavioral needs of students.
QualificationsVirginia teaching license preferred; minimum of three years successful teaching experience, special education classroom experience preferred; thorough knowledge of instructional methods, strategies, and practices that support educational needs of students struggling with behavior challenges; knowledge of special education regulations; qualities and personal characteristics necessary for working with professional colleagues, students, and parents; ability to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ing;
enrolled or plan to enroll in a program that is approved by the BACB and meets the instructional requirements for eligibility to sit for the Behavior Analysis Certification Board exam within 3 years of accepting the position.
